[quote name='dizdaz']If there is a limit of $60 gaming coupons per member, does that mean I can't get Crysis 2 and get a $15 coupon and get mortal kombat and portal 2 with the $60 coupon? That's $75 of coupons so how would it work[/QUOTE]

I think you may have confused the details of the promotion. You get a $15 coupon for spending $40, and if you reach $120, you get an additional $45 coupon bringing the coupon total to sixty. There is no individual $60 coupon, it's the sum of the two.

Also, please note that buying Crisis 2 ($39.99) by itself puts you a penny short of earning the first coupon. You're better off buying all the games in one transaction. (The coupons you earn aren't valid for use until next week.)
